23. Re: [DELAWARE] PA and DE [1]
Portions of what is now Chester and Delaware Counties lines adjoining Delaware were often not clearly marked and many people lived in either PA or Del. and in many cases no one is certain as to which. I have found many of these circumstances in my searches and also this can include the PA line with MD between Chester and Cecil Counties. Good hunting - it is difficult at best.
